Confirmed Lineups
Celtic 1. Viljami Sinisalo 2. Alistair Johnston 3. Auston Trusty 4. Liam Scales 5. Kieran Tierney 6. Callum McGregor 7. Arne Engels 8. Yang Hyun-Jun 9. Benjamin Nygren 10. Luke McCowan 11. Daizen Maeda
Rangers 1. Jack Butland 2. James Tavernier 3. Nasser Djiga 4. Emmanuel Fernandez 5. Tuur Rommens 6. Tochi Chukwuani 7. Connor Barron 8. Oliver Antman 9. Mohammed Diomande 10. Mikey Moore 11. Youssef Chermiti
